Truancy Diversion may be in for a revival

For a good run of several years, our Parkersburg site of CHS operated a highly regarded and successful truancy diversion program in Wood County schools. (And for several years, in 8 counties surrounding our office) Wood County schools always appreciated the working relationship we had, and the value of a designated worker in the schools to deal with positive attendance accountability, and the special needs of children with attendance problems and school motivation issues. Well, an exciting possibility has opened up where Wood County schools may be interested in our contracting for one truancy diversion worker to work in Van Devender Middle school to finish the last quarter of this school year, and then contract for the 2009-2010 school year! We hope to have some final details on this possibility very soon, and will keep everyone informed!
